Our first production day was supposed to start early in the morning and knowing that some of us had to go to the M Stores we had to change our schedule a bit (the schedule is available in the previous post) Thankfully everyone was on time, however, setting up the lights and figuring out their position in a very small space took us quite a while and that is why we were almost one hour behind the schedule. Luckily, our actress Fleur who played Joe was doing an amazing job which helped us a lot in getting back on track in terms of time.
Overall, we managed to do all the shots we wanted which is absolutely amazing and left us feeling content with the day, however, it was clearly tiring and stressful as we weren’t really taught the roles on set and we only had two people from moving image which was the reason why, for instance, sound designers had to replace AC, AD, sparks and other roles which clearly affected our workflow. Another thing was that there were no gaffers on set which was also quite problematic as we had to work with lights and their positioning a lot. I used to work with lights a bit in my own practice so had a few lighting schemes in mind and tried to come up with something in addition to working with the camera and I am really thankful to all the crew members for being really supportive and helpful. Despite this issue and the stress raised by it we still managed to find some great solutions that we will use further in our practice, for example, when Sara and Marta found a way to replace the TV light with small lights led lights we’ve rented as props. This once again proved to us that the key in learning is experimenting practically, yet, it could save us a lot of time, nerves, and energy if we could actually learn such things during the moving image sessions as I find this kind of knowledge crucial for the production process.
Our final issue for that day was that in the end, we had to shoot a small scene for the dream part with the male crew members in Joe’s apartment, yet some of the actors couldn’t make it due to being tested as positive for covid. Luckily, Bethany’s aunt and uncle came to visit her in the evening and her uncle was really kind to help us play the director.
